Clarifying Common Misunderstandings About Public Records
A major misunderstanding is that expungement completely erases all traces of an arrest. In reality, certain government and执法 agencies may still access sealed records under specific legal circumstances. Another myth is that using an online form or calling the FDLE Expungement Phone Number guarantees a quick outcome. The reality is that court processing times can vary, and some applications require review by multiple offices. Some people also assume that once records are sealed, they cannot be accessed for any purpose, but background checks for security clearances or specific licensing may still reveal them. Recognizing these nuances builds trust and helps people make thoughtful, informed choices rather than decisions based on incomplete information.
